What is CVE-2023-1294?

A SQL injection vulnerability exists in the File Tracker Manager System 1.0 from SourceCodester, particularly within the POST Parameter Handler component in the file /file_manager/login.php. This flaw allows attackers to manipulate the username parameter, possibly leading to unauthorized access and data exposure. The vulnerability can be exploited remotely, posing significant risks to affected systems. Awareness and prompt remediation are essential to mitigate potential abuse of this publicly disclosed vulnerability.
